Sometimes, you have to leave home to find yourself.

That was definitely true for acclaimed international artist Alteronce Gumby, and it’s true for too many Harrisburg natives who feel they can’t fulfill their dreams in central Pennsylvania.

We heard it loud and clear from Harrisburg University students who participated in our latest roundtable on the city’s economic development. These students are bursting at the seams with creativity and drive, but they see nowhere to channel it in Harrisburg.

The story of Alteronce Gumby is a glaring example of why many youths have to leave our region to discover their unique and undeniable genius. But how proud their community is when they return home, accomplished and successful.

That pride was evident Saturday evening at the Susquehanna Museum of Art (SAM) as Gumby stood before a room of beaming friends and relatives, all doting on his every word…
